FEELING LUCKY? The covetable Cattle Baron's Ball raffle items TICK, TICK The recently debuted Rolex Sea-Dweller, donated by Eiseman Jewels NorthPark Center and Rolex, adds sporty prestige to your wrist. Bonus points for water resistance to 4,000 feet. Value: $10,400 MARGARITAS, ANYONE? Beachfront villas. Lavish spa treatments. Romantic seaside dinners. All part of a seven-night stay at a private residence at Esperanza Cabo San Lucas, Auberge Resorts Collection, donated by Inspirato. Value: $6,000 ARM CANDY À DEUX Dallas designer Susie Straubmueller has donated two fashionable bags: a taupe python tote for Sunday brunches at La Bilboquet and a vibrant pink python clutch for cocktails at the Mansion Bar. Value: $5,000 BLANK CHECK A splurge is on the horizon, with a $10,000 debit card from PlainsCapital Bank. The question remains: a precious bauble or an exotic getaway? Value: $10,000 INSIDE THE BOX Your porte-cochère just got better looking, with help from the 2017 Porsche 718 Boxster, a speedy roadster donated by Park Place Porsche. Value: $65,000 SHOPAHOLICS ANONYMOUS A driver will fetch and deliver you to one destination: Highland Park Village. The luxury center has offered $10,000 to spend at any of its boutiques. A personal shopper will assist, and your wardrobe will thank you. Value: $10,000 ENTER TO WIN: A single raffle ticket goes for $25; five tickets cost you $100. May the odds be ever in your favor. IN RESIDENCE Talk about a chic staycation: Move into the penthouse at Le Méridien Dallas, The Stoneleigh hotel, for the weekend; summon eight friends for cocktails at Top Knot followed by dinner at Uchi. HOW 'BOUT THEM COWBOYS Carlson Capital has donated its Ring of Honor Suite at AT&T Stadium for the famous Dallas Cowboys Thanksgiving Day game. With room for 19, it's the power spot to watch the Boys take on the Washington Redskins. BIG BOARD AUCTION CAT'S MEOW Prepare the vault for a platinum and 18K gold David Webb tiger ring, swathed in cabochon emeralds and brilliant-cut diamonds. SILVER-SCREEN CHIC Reel FX studios opens its doors for a VIP, behind-the- scenes tour of an animated-film production, and tête-à- tête with the filmmakers. INTO THE WILD Courtesy David Denies Wingshooting, a dove-hunting adventure for seven takes you to Argentina for three nights where you'll settle in at the elite Córdoba Lodge.
